天天看點

linux 檢視網卡以及開啟網卡

1、檢視并配置設定虛拟網絡

  我們首先要知道 VMware 三種網絡模式的差別。

  ①、Bridged(橋接模式):就是将主機網卡與虛拟機虛拟的網卡利用虛拟網橋進行通信。在橋接的作用下,類似于把實體主機虛拟為一個交換機,所有橋接設定的虛拟機連接配接到這個交換機的一個接口上,實體主機也同樣插在這個交換機當中,是以所有橋接下的網卡與網卡都是交換模式的,互相可以通路而不幹擾。在橋接模式下,虛拟機ip位址需要與主機在同一個網段,如果需要聯網,則網關與DNS需要與主機網卡一緻。

  ②、NAT(網絡位址轉換模式):主機網卡直接與虛拟NAT裝置相連,然後虛拟NAT裝置與虛拟DHCP伺服器一起連接配接在虛拟交換機VMnet8上,這樣就實作了虛拟機聯網。

  ③、Host-Only(僅主機模式):其實就是NAT模式去除了虛拟NAT裝置,然後使用VMware Network Adapter VMnet1虛拟網卡連接配接VMnet1虛拟交換機來與虛拟機通信的,Host-Only模式将虛拟機與外網隔開,使得虛拟機成為一個獨立的系統,隻與主機互相通訊。

  這裡我們選擇 NAT 模式。  

  

linux 檢視網卡以及開啟網卡
  通過VMWare -> Edit -> Virtual Network Editor打開如下對話框:
linux 檢視網卡以及開啟網卡

  由上圖可知:虛拟網卡VMnet8 的子網 IP 為 192.168.146.0,子網路遮罩為:255.255.255.0

  點選上圖的 NAT 設定:

linux 檢視網卡以及開啟網卡

由此我們可以得出:

  子網ip:192.168.146.0

  子網路遮罩:255.255.255.0

  預設網關:192.168.146.2

那麼我們可以得出:

  hostname                ipaddress                subnet mask                  geteway    

1、 master     192.168.146.200    255.255.255.0      192.168.146.2

2、 slave1      192.168.146.201    255.255.255.0      192.168.146.2

3、 slave2      192.168.146.202    255.255.255.0      192.168.146.2

  後面的主機可以依次相加

注意:這裡可以根據自己本機的 ip 進行虛拟機ip配置設定,主機名要不一樣,ip位址要不一樣

2、開啟虛拟機服務

   我的電腦----> 管理 ------>服務和應用程式------>服務

linux 檢視網卡以及開啟網卡

3、配置網絡

  以 root 使用者登入 Linux 虛拟機,輸入如下指令配置 ip

1

​vi /etc/sysconfig/network-scripts/ifcfg-eth0​

  将下面内容添加到打開的檔案中

2

3

​IPADDR=​

​​

​192.168​

​.​

​146.200​

​NETMASK=​

​255.255​

​.​

​255.0​

​GATEWAY=​

​192.168​

​.​

​146.2​

最後顯示結果為:

linux 檢視網卡以及開啟網卡

  DEVICE=eth0【網卡名稱】

  HWADDR=00:07:E9:05:E8:B4 #對應的網卡網卡位址,即mac位址(檔案裡可以沒有)

  TYPE=Ethernet#表示網絡類型是以太網

  UUID:網卡的UUID(檔案裡可以沒有)

  ONBOOT=yes【開機加載】

  BOOTPROTO=static【是否自動擷取,static是靜态位址】

  IPADDR=192.168.146.200【配置你的本地IP】

  NETMASK=255.255.255.0【子網路遮罩】

  GATEWAY=192.168.146.2【預設網關】

 輸入完成後,按ESC 鍵,然後輸入“:wq”,即儲存退出

4、配置 DNS

​vi /etc/resolv.conf​

  輸入:

​nameserver ​

​192.168​

​.​

​146.2​

輸入完成後,按ESC 鍵,然後輸入“:wq”,即儲存退出  

如果不進行 DNS 配置,那麼隻能和真實實體機通信, ping www.baidu.com 是不通的

5、重新開機網卡,使得配置生效

​server  network restart​

6、關閉防火牆

  如果你 ping 本機真實ip位址,不通,那麼需要關閉防火牆

​①、 即時生效,重新開機後複原​

​開啟: service iptables start​

​關閉: service iptables stop​

​② 、永久性生效,重新開機後不會複原​

​開啟: chkconfig iptables on​

​關閉: chkconfig iptables off​

   具體操作為:

  service iptables stop

  chkconfig iptables off

那麼第一台虛拟機配置完成。接着可以利用 vmware 的克隆功能克隆出其他的虛拟機

第一步:關閉 虛拟機

​shutdown -h now​

 

第二步:克隆

  利用 VMware 的克隆工具,右鍵 虛拟機名字---》管理----》克隆   。然後都是下一步下一步操作即可。

  這裡我們用 上面的虛拟機克隆出另外一台虛拟機 slave1

第三步:克隆完成後,開啟虛拟機 slave1 。然後配置IP。

  注意:完成以後啟動克隆的虛拟機,使用者名和密碼都是被克隆的linux的使用者名密碼

     ①、由于是完全的克隆過來的 Linux 是以需要更改這幾項:作業系統實體位址、IP位址、主機名

     ②、删除網卡中的UUID和實體位址HWADDR(這兩行在Linux重新開機之後,作業系統會自動生成的)

  1、以 root 使用者登入 slave1 ,輸入如下指令: 

​vi /etc/sysconfig/network-scripts/ifcfg-eth0​

  将 IP 改為 192.168.146.201,去掉 UUID 和 HWADDR 這兩行

   

linux 檢視網卡以及開啟網卡

 2、接下來修改主機名:在指令中輸入

​vi  /etc/sysconfig/network​

  修改為:

linux 檢視網卡以及開啟網卡

 3、删除Linux實體位址綁定的檔案(該檔案會在作業系統重新開機并生成實體位址以後将實體位址綁定到IP上);

   輸入如下指令:

​rm -rf /etc/udev/rules.d/​

​70​

​-persistent-net.rules​

 4、輸入 shutdown -r now 重新開機系統

然後我們輸入 ifconfig 發現 IP 已經更改了

linux 檢視網卡以及開啟網卡

是以:我們可以克隆出 slave2,slave3 等虛拟機,在依次這樣更改 IP 配置即可互相 ping 通。

繼續閱讀